At Finsbury Flowers, we understand that letter tribute flowers are a personal and meaningful way to express your feelings, celebrate a life, or honour special memories in our community. Proudly rooted in the heart of Finsbury, our experienced florists craft bespoke flower letters and tributes with care, creativity, and the quality you'd expect from a trusted local florist.

Whether you’re remembering a loved one or marking a special occasion, our range of fresh bouquets and floral tributes cater to every sentiment. We're honoured to support families and friends across Clerkenwell, Angel, and King's Cross, delivering right to local chapels and homes near landmarks such as Exmouth Market and St John Street.
